Yahoo, who has already turned down a number of buy-out offers from Microsoft this year, has reportedly changed its tune after last week’s implosion of the search ad partnership deal it had hoped to make with Google.
Today, despite earlier eleventh-hour attempts to adjust the deal to make it work, Google walked away from its proposed search ad partnership deal with Yahoo.
Several news sites reported today that the long-in-the-making search advertising partnership between Yahoo and Google — which we’ve been following with interest here at the Aplus.net Blog because of the implications it has for the entire world of online commerce — was changed dramatically when the companies agreed to “scale back” the scope of the merger in order to improve their chances of federal approval.
